Why the pool matters more than it seems

In the heat of Cartagena, the pool is not a luxury. It is frequently used infrastructure. Between 11:00 am and 4:00 pm, the sun is intense enough for the open sea to become uncomfortable for many people. The hotel’s pool is the intermediate point: fresh water, shade nearby, without sand, without vendors, with room service within reach.

For families with young children, the pool matters even more. The environment can be controlled. Children play without the currents of the open sea. Adults can really relax.

What the photo of the pool does not say

the actual size. Some hotel pools in Cartagena are decorative. Eight or ten meters long, not deep enough to swim well. The photo does not say.

What floor is it on? A pool on the second floor of a building surrounded by other buildings does not have a sea view, although the hotel is in Bocagrande. Panoramic involves height and open lines of sight. It does not arrive automatically with the location.

Who else uses it. Some hotels share the pool with an adjacent residential building, which can mean restricted hours or saturation in high season.

the temperature of the water. Pool water in Cartagena can get very hot during the day. Hotels with a cooling system or sufficient shade over the pool make a real difference in practice.

What to ask before booking a hotel with a pool in Cartagena

It is worth asking directly before confirming:

On what floor is the pool and has a direct sea view? What is the size (length and width)? Is there an area of sunbeds and umbrellas? Is there a drink service at the pool? Do you have restricted hours? Is it for exclusive use for hotel guests?

These questions avoid the type of disappointment that cannot be resolved once at the destination.

Pool vs Beach: How to use both in Cartagena

The heat of Cartagena is real. not the manageable temperature of Medellin or the dry cold of Bogotá. It is humid Caribbean heat, and the sun between 10:00 am and 3:00 pm is intense enough to make the time outside genuinely uncomfortable if it is not managed well.

The structure that works best for a hotel with pool and beach:

Early morning (6:30 to 10:00 am): beach before the sun gets serious. The Caribbean breeze at that time makes a completely different experience from the noon.

Noon (10:00 am to 3:00 pm): Pool, lunch in the hotel restaurant, rest in the room. It is when the open sea is less pleasant and the pool justifies its place.

afternoon (3:00 pm onwards): Back to the beach or pool, or exit to the historic center, an excursion or where you take the day.

A hotel with the two options eliminates the need to arrange taxis, wait or plan around nothing. He rotates between the two depending on how he feels.

Other Hotels with a Pool in Cartagena: What to Consider

The historic center has boutique hotels with swimming pools on terraces or inner courtyards. Elegant spaces, but without sea views. For travelers who prioritize colonial architecture on the beach, they may be the right choice.

In Bocagrande, most of the middle and high-class hotels have a swimming pool. The differences are in the view, the size and whether the hotel has direct access to the beach or only proximity to the public beach.

The Laguito, in the Punta de Bocagrande, has some more exclusive hotels with pools on high floors and views in different directions.
